
A grieving family from Tongaren, Bungoma County, has been double-victimised by a rogue lawyer who exploited their vulnerability following the fatal road accident death of their kin, Job Simiyu Wafula, in Kirinyaga County on 24th January 2026.
Hudson Sitati Wamukota, an advocate operating under the unregistered firm Hudson Sitati & Company Advocates, induced David Wanjala Siundu and his family to pay him in excess of Ksh. 1.5 million over approximately two months, falsely representing that the claims would yield a minimum of Ksh. 20 million in compensation.
No formal retainer, client brief, or fee agreement was ever executed as required under the Advocates Act.
The consequences have been devastating.
Esther Naliaka, wife of David Wanjala, died on Wednesday morning from hypertension she developed in April upon discovering the family had been defrauded — making the lawyer’s conduct the proximate cause of a second death in the same household.
Her body is lying at Kiminini Hospital mortuary.
The family shop business they relied upon has been closed over diminished stock.
Wamukota has since acknowledged obtaining the funds but has offered only excuses in place of a refund.
Complaints lodged with both the Advocates Complaints Commission and the Law Society of Kenya have thus far been met with an inexcusably slow response, leaving the family without redress while facing compounded grief and financial ruin.
The Consumers Federation of Kenya has now formally intervened, demanding accountability through all available civil, criminal, disciplinary, and constitutional avenues.
COFEK lawyers have since taken up the Kerugoya fatal accident matter.
